Pre 1997.....

On my 1991 I took that entire dump valve assembly completely apart, got rid of the elbows, separated the drains and redid did the system there to get it up higher..

All that "junk" hangs down so far its very vulnerable to damage, especially now that our rigs don't sit as high in the rear as they did when new...

On the gray water dump valve as you can see (rear valve) I used a cap with the garden hose outlet as it can easily be emptied in a number of places.
